How to Buy a Luxury Home in Zagreb, Croatia

Zagreb, the vibrant capital of Croatia, offers a rich blend of history, culture, and modern amenities, making it an attractive location for luxury home buyers. If you're considering purchasing a luxury property in this beautiful city, follow these essential steps to navigate the process smoothly.

1. Understand the Market

Before diving into the luxury real estate market in Zagreb, it’s crucial to familiarize yourself with current market trends. Research neighborhoods that are known for luxury living, such as Gradec, Kaptol, and Tuškanac. Look into recent sales, average property prices, and market forecasts to get a comprehensive view of what to expect.

2. Set a Budget

Establishing a clear budget is vital when looking to purchase a luxury home. Consider not only the purchase price but also additional costs such as property taxes, maintenance fees, furnishing, and renovation costs. This will ensure you have a well-rounded understanding of your financial commitment.

3. Engage a Local Real Estate Agent

Working with a knowledgeable real estate agent who specializes in luxury properties is a key step in the buying process. They can provide invaluable insights into the market, help identify properties that meet your criteria, and negotiate on your behalf. Look for agents with a strong track record in luxury real estate in Zagreb.

4. Evaluate Properties Carefully

When viewing potential homes, pay close attention to the quality of construction, location, and amenities. Luxury properties often boast features like stunning views, updated kitchens, and expansive outdoor spaces. It’s also beneficial to consider the property’s resale value and potential for appreciation in the coming years.

5. Conduct Thorough Due Diligence

After identifying a property you are interested in, it’s essential to conduct thorough due diligence. This includes reviewing the property’s legal status, ensuring all documentation is in order, and checking for any liens or claims against the property. Hiring a local attorney can help navigate legal complexities and safeguard your investment.

6. Make an Offer

Once you’ve found the right property, work with your real estate agent to craft a competitive offer. In the luxury market, your offer may have to meet or exceed asking prices, especially if the property has unique features or is in a sought-after location. Be prepared for negotiations, and stay flexible to ensure a successful transaction.

7. Finalize Financing

If you require financing for your luxury home, consult with banks or private lenders that offer services to foreign buyers in Croatia. Having pre-approval can give you an edge in the negotiation process and helps streamline the purchasing process.

8. Close the Deal

Finally, once your offer is accepted, you’ll move towards closing. This process involves signing contracts, transferring funds, and registering the property in your name. Ensure that all conditions of the sale are met, and don’t hesitate to seek assistance from professionals such as real estate lawyers to avoid any pitfalls.
